Re: I Got Pro Tools 7.3 to recognize 2.7GB of memory- Here's how
Thanks bro. Does the userva cap off the ram so the system does not crash? And if it does would the system crash because protools used over it's limit? I need to understand this
__________________
"It aint about the stuff you got..If it sounds right you're finished..Burn it!" For all complaints click here DAW-Digi003 PC-Sweetwater CS dual 3.0/Asus 975X Chipset/CPU dual 3.0GHz/800MHz FSB/RAM 4GB/Radeonx300se/4 internal glyph sata drives/ 3 external glyph backup drives/Acronis True Image OUTBOARD-UA LA-610, ADL-600, Digimax lt, Eureka x 2, Central Station, Hearback x 8, JBL LSR, Monster Power Software-PTLE 8.0, Sound Forge, CD Architect Plugins- Too many and too much money spent |
#439
|
||||
|
||||
Re: I Got Pro Tools 7.3 to recognize 2.7GB of memory- Here's how
it'll cap what PTLE or any app can use. as far as what would happen...it'll just put you in the same situation as before except at a higher ram usage. IOW, whether the switches are there or not when the limit is reached the app could stop respondin', crash, or start producin' audible artifacts in the playback or recording. each situation would be dependent on the type of interrupt that is bein' issued when/while the limit is bein' hit/reached IMHO....for example...Key uses the switch and actually reached 3.12gb of ram without crashin'. he heard clicks and pops durin' playback but that was it. now had he tried to bring up QT at that same time he probably would have had more than just clicks and pops. make sense???
